Housing Stock in Pilawa Municipality 2023
In 2023, Pilawa municipality ranked 832 of 2,478 Polish municipalities. Dwelling stock grew by 292 units +8.59% between 2018-2023, reaching 3,690.
Among 494 growing municipalities, ranked in top 30% for housing growth rate. Within Garwoliński county, ranked 3 of 14 municipalities. In Masovian province, ranked 96.
Based on 31 years of official GUS housing market statistics for Garwoliński county municipalities within Masovian province.
